Overview Isofast 40mg Tablet SR

Isofast 40mg Extended-Release Tablets function as both a vasodilator and uterine relaxant. This medication treats premature labor, characterized by the uterus contracting prematurely, and aids in managing peripheral vascular disorders. Isofast 40mg ER Tablets may be ingested with or without food, but consistent timing maximizes therapeutic effect. Dosage and frequency are determined by your physician based on your specific condition and response. Always adhere to your doctor's prescribed regimen. Swallow the tablets whole with water. Continue treatment for the duration prescribed. Lightheadedness is a frequently reported side effect. Report any concerning or persistent side effects immediately to your physician. To mitigate dizziness, rise slowly from a seated or recumbent position and avoid activities requiring alertness, such as driving. Prior to commencing treatment, inform your doctor of any pre-existing cardiac conditions or bleeding disorders, and provide a complete list of all current medications, as interactions may impact Isofast's efficacy. To minimize the risk of premature labor, avoid strenuous exertion and stressful situations.

Common Side effects of Isofast 40mg Tablet SR:

  • Dizziness
  • Palpitations
  • Vomiting
  • Nausea
  • Flushing (sense of warmth in the face, ears, neck and trunk)
  • Weakness
  • Decreased blood pressure

How to use Isofast 40mg Tablet SR:

Administer this medication precisely as your physician directs, adhering to both the prescribed dosage and treatment period. Ingest the tablet whole; avoid chewing, crushing, or fracturing it. Isofast 40mg Extended-Release Tablets can be consumed with or without food, though consistent timing is recommended.

How Isofast 40mg Tablet SR works:

Isofast 40mg sustained-release tablets contain a beta-adrenergic agonist that inhibits uterine smooth muscle contractions, thereby suppressing preterm labor. This medication also promotes vasodilation, enhancing blood flow and improving circulation to extremities like the hands and feet, and the brain. Consequently, it offers therapeutic benefits in managing peripheral vascular disorders.

What if you forget to take Isofast 40mg Tablet SR :

Should you forget to take your Isofast 40mg Tablet SR, administer it immediately upon remembering.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
